How Burst Pipe Damage Cleanup Actually Works
When a pipe bursts, the clock starts ticking. The longer water sits, the more damage it causes. That’s why our process is designed for rapid deployment and efficient water removal. We understand the critical nature of the first 24 to 48 hours after damage occurs. A hurried or incomplete cleanup can lead to lingering problems and much higher costs down the road, which is why we follow a proven method to ensure complete and lasting restoration.
1. Emergency Water Extraction
Once we arrive on your property, our first priority is to remove standing water. We use powerful truck-mounted and portable water extractors to pull out as much water as possible. This step is critical for minimizing water saturation and preventing further damage to your floors, walls, and belongings. We aim to complete this phase within the first few hours.
2. Advanced Moisture Detection
After the bulk of the water is gone, we use specialized equipment like mo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ras to find hidden water. This helps us locate water trapped within walls, under floors, or in ceilings. Identifying all affected areas is key to a thorough and effective drying plan.
3. Structural Drying and Dehumidification
We set up industrial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ers throughout the affected areas. These machines work tirelessly to pull moisture from the air and building materials, accelerating the drying process. Our goal is to return your home to its normal humidity levels and prevent long-term structural issues. This stage can take several days, depending on the extent of the damage.
4. Content Restoration and Cleaning
While drying your home, we also assess and clean your belongings. Items like furniture, carpets, and personal possessions are carefully evaluated. Some may be salvageable with professional cleaning, while others might need to be discarded. We focus on restoring as much as possible to help you recover your valued items.
5. Odor Control and Sanitation
Water damage can leave behind unpleasant odors and create an environment for bacteria and mold. We use professional-grade antimicrobial and deodorizing treatments to neutralize odors and sanitize affected surfaces. This step ensures your home is not only dry but also safe and healthy again.

Warning Signs You Need Burst Pipe Damage Cleanup
Catching the signs of a burst pipe or ongoing water leak early can save you a lot of money and prevent major structural problems. Ignoring small issues can escalate quickly. Pay attention to these indicators that suggest you need professional help for burst pipe water damage.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ent damp, musty smell, especially in basements or crawl spaces, is a strong indicator of hidden moisture. This smell often signals that water has been present long enough for mold or mildew to begin growing, requiring immediate professional cleanup.
Discolored or Sagging Walls and Ceilings
If you notice new stains, peeling paint, or areas where drywall or plaster seems to be sagging, water is likely present behind the surface. This is a clear sign of significant water intrusion that needs prompt attention before structural integrity is compromised.
Unexplained High Water Bills
A sudden, unexplained spike in your water bill can point to a hidden leak, possibly from a burst pipe within your walls or under your foundation. This is a clear signal for expert leak detection and repair.
Pooling Water or Damp Spots
Visible puddles of water on your floors, or constantly damp spots on carpets or subflooring, are direct evidence of a leak. This requires immediate water extraction and drying to prevent further damage.
Sound of Running Water When No Fixtures Are On
If you can hear dripping, hissing, or the sound of running water when all faucets and appliances are off, it’s a strong indication of a leak somewhere in your plumbing system. This is a critical alert for emergency plumbing services.
Peeling or Bubbling Wallpaper
Water trapped behind wallpaper can cause it to lose its adhesive and bubble or peel away from the wall. This often means there’s been prolonged water exposure requiring professional drying.
Burst Pipe Damage Cleanup v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water in a small area (e.g., a few square feet) | Yes, with caution | Yes, if unsure | DIY is okay for minor spills, but professionals have equipment for deeper drying. |
| Water has saturated carpets and padding | No | Yes | Carpets and padding hold a lot of water and require specialized extraction and drying. |
| Water has seeped into wal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Hidden moisture can cause mold and structural damage if not professionally dried. |
| Burst pipe caused significant flooding throughout multiple rooms | No | Yes | Large-scale water damage requires industrial equipment and expertise for complete restoration. |
| You suspect mold growth already | No | Yes | Mold remediation requires specialized safety protocols and equipment. |
| Electrical outlets or appliances are near the water source | No | Yes | Safety is paramount; professionals can assess and mitigate electrical hazards. |

What should I do immediately after discovering a burst pipe?
Your immediate priority is safety. If you can, shut off the main water supply to your home to stop the flow. Next, if it’s safe to do so, unplug any electrical devices in the affected area. How long does burst pipe cleanup and drying typically take?
The timeline for burst pipe damage cleanup can vary greatly, but the initial water extraction is usually completed within hours. The structural drying process, however, can take anywhere from three to seven days, depending on the extent of the water damage and the building materials involved. We use advanced equipment to speed up this process as much as possible.
Is burst pipe water considered a biohazard?
Water from a burst pipe is often considered “gray water” if it comes from a fixture like a sink or toilet that doesn’t contain waste. However, if the water has been sitting for a while, or if it comes into contact with sewage or contaminants, it can become “black water,” which is a serious biohazard. Our team is equipped to handle all types of water damage, ensuring safe and thorough sanitation.
What kind of equipment do you use for burst pipe cleanup?
We utilize a range of professional-grade equipment, including powerful truck-mounted and portable water extractors, industrial-strength dehumidifiers, high-velocity air movers, and advanced moisture detection tools like thermal imaging cameras and hygrometers. This specialized gear allows us to extract water efficiently and ensure complete structural drying.
Will my homeowner’s insurance cover burst pipe damage cleanup?
In most cases, homeowner’s insurance policies cover damage caused by sudden and accidental bursts of pipes. However, coverage can vary, and policies often exclude damage from neglect or lack of maintenance.
